Important differences between yogurt and sunflower seeds

  • Yogurt has less vitamin E, copper, vitamin B1, vitamin B6, manganese, selenium, phosphorus, magnesium, iron, and folate.
  • Sunflower seeds' daily need coverage for vitamin E is 234% more.

The food varieties used in the comparison are Yogurt, Greek, plain, nonfat and Seeds, sunflower seed kernels, dried.
